gpt4 book ai didi

python - isalpha python 函数不会考虑空格

转载 作者:太空狗 更新时间:2023-10-29 20:43:50 28 4
gpt4 key购买 nike

所以下面的代码接受一个输入并确保输入由字母而不是数字组成。如果输入包含空格,我如何使它也打印原始

original = raw_input("Type the name of the application: ")

if original.isalpha() and len(original) > 0:
print original
else:
print "empty"

尝试了这段代码,但当输入也是数字时也能正常工作。

original = raw_input("Type the word you want to change: ")

if original.isalpha() or len(original) > 0:
print original
else:
print "empty"

最佳答案

看起来字符串就是这样工作的。

两种选择:

if all(x.isalpha() or x.isspace() for x in original):

(根据下面 inspectorG4dget 的建议修改)

original.replace(' ','').isalpha()

应该可以。

关于python - isalpha python 函数不会考虑空格,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/20890618/

28 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com